import math
from numbers import Number
import random
from copy import deepcopy
import pandas as pd
from tabulate import tabulate
import torch
from torch import nn
import numpy as np
from .common import *
def _uniform_batch(min_, max_, shape=(1,), device='cpu'):
return torch.rand(shape, device=device) * (max_ - min_) + min_
def _normal_batch(scale=1.0, loc=0.0, shape=(1,), device='cpu'):
return torch.randn(shape, device=device) * scale + loc
def _randint_batch(min_, max_, shape=(1,), device='cpu'):
return torch.randint(min_, max_, shape, device=device)
class CalibratedNoisyPairGenerator(nn.Module):
def __init__(self, opt, device='cuda') -> None:
super().__init__()
self.device = device
self.opt = deepcopy(opt)
self.camera_params = opt['camera_params']
self.camera_params = self.param_dict_to_tensor_dict(self.camera_params)
self.cameras = list(self.camera_params.keys())
print('Current Using Cameras: ', self.cameras)
self.noise_type = opt['noise_type'].lower()
self.read_type = 'TukeyLambda' if 't' in self.noise_type else \
('Gaussian' if 'g' in self.noise_type else None)
def param_dict_to_tensor_dict(self, p_dict):
def to_tensor_dict(p_dict):
for k, v in p_dict.items():
if isinstance(v, list) or isinstance(v, Number):
p_dict[k] = nn.Parameter(torch.tensor(v, device=self.device), False)
elif isinstance(v, dict):
p_dict[k] = to_tensor_dict(v)
return p_dict
return to_tensor_dict(p_dict)
def sample_overall_system_gain(self, batch_size, for_video):
if self.index is None:
self.index = _randint_batch(0, len(self.camera_params)).item()
self.current_camera = self.cameras[self.index]
self.current_camera_params = self.camera_params[self.current_camera]
self.current_k_range = [
self.camera_params[self.current_camera]['Kmin'],
self.camera_params[self.current_camera]['Kmax']
]
log_K_max = torch.log(self.current_camera_params['Kmax'])
log_K_min = torch.log(self.current_camera_params['Kmin'])
log_K = _uniform_batch(log_K_min, log_K_max, (batch_size, 1, 1, 1), self.device)
if for_video:
log_K = log_K.unsqueeze(-1)
self.log_K = log_K
self.cur_batch_size = batch_size
return torch.exp(log_K)
def sample_read_sigma(self):
slope = self.current_camera_params[self.read_type]['slope']
bias = self.current_camera_params[self.read_type]['bias']
sigma = self.current_camera_params[self.read_type]['sigma']
mu = self.log_K.squeeze() * slope + bias
sample = _normal_batch(sigma, mu, (self.cur_batch_size,), self.device)
return torch.exp(sample).reshape(self.log_K.shape)
def sample_tukey_lambda(self, batch_size, for_video):
index = _randint_batch(0, len(self.current_camera_params[self.read_type]['lambda']), shape=(batch_size,))
tukey_lambdas = self.current_camera_params[self.read_type]['lambda'][index].reshape(batch_size, 1, 1, 1)
if for_video:
tukey_lambdas = tukey_lambdas.unsqueeze(1)
return tukey_lambdas
def sample_row_sigma(self):
slope = self.current_camera_params['Row']['slope']
bias = self.current_camera_params['Row']['bias']
sigma = self.current_camera_params['Row']['sigma']
mu = self.log_K.squeeze() * slope + bias
sample = _normal_batch(sigma, mu, (self.cur_batch_size,), self.device)
return torch.exp(sample).reshape(self.log_K.squeeze(-3).shape)
def sample_color_bias(self, batch_size, for_video):
count = len(self.current_camera_params['ColorBias'])
i_range = (self.current_k_range[1] - self.current_k_range[0]) / count
index = ((torch.exp(self.log_K.squeeze()) - self.current_k_range[0]) // i_range).long()
color_bias = self.current_camera_params['ColorBias'][index]
color_bias = color_bias.reshape(batch_size, 4, 1, 1)
if for_video:
color_bias = color_bias.unsqueeze(1)
return color_bias
@staticmethod
def add_noise(img, noise, noise_params):
tail = [1 for _ in range(img.dim() - 1)]
ratio = noise_params['isp_dgain'].view(-1, *tail)
scale = noise_params['scale'].view(-1, 4, *tail[:-1])
for n in noise.values():
img += n
img /= scale
img = img * ratio
return torch.clamp(img, max=1.0)
@torch.no_grad()
def forward(self, img, scale, ratio, vcam_id=None):
b = img.size(0)
for_video = True if img.dim() == 5 else False # B, T, C, H, W
self.index = vcam_id if vcam_id is not None else None
img_gt = torch.clamp(img, 0, 1)
tail = [1 for _ in range(img.dim() - 1)]
img = img_gt * scale.view(-1, 4, *tail[:-1]) / ratio.view(-1, *tail)
K = self.sample_overall_system_gain(b, for_video)
noise = {}
noise_params = {'isp_dgain': ratio, 'scale': scale}
# shot noise
if 'p' in self.noise_type:
_shot_noise = shot_noise(img, K)
noise['shot'] = _shot_noise
noise_params['shot'] = K.squeeze()
# read noise
if 'g' in self.noise_type:
read_param = self.sample_read_sigma()
_read_noise = gaussian_noise(img, read_param)
noise['read'] = _read_noise
noise_params['read'] = read_param.squeeze()
elif 't' in self.noise_type:
tukey_lambda = self.sample_tukey_lambda(b, for_video)
read_param = self.sample_read_sigma()
_read_noise = tukey_lambda_noise(img, read_param, tukey_lambda)
noise['read'] = _read_noise
noise_params['read'] = {
'sigma': read_param,
'tukey_lambda': tukey_lambda
}
# row noise
if 'r' in self.noise_type:
row_param = self.sample_row_sigma()
_row_noise = row_noise(img, row_param)
noise['row'] = _row_noise
noise_params['row'] = row_param.squeeze()
# quant noise
if 'q' in self.noise_type:
_quant_noise = quant_noise(img, 1)
noise['quant'] = _quant_noise
# color bias
if 'c' in self.noise_type:
color_bias = self.sample_color_bias(b, for_video)
noise['color_bias'] = color_bias
img_lq = self.add_noise(img, noise, noise_params)
return img_gt, img_lq, {
'cam': self.current_camera,
'noise': noise,
'noise_params': noise_params
}
def __len__(self):
return len(self.cameras)
def cpu(self):
super().cpu()
self.device = 'cpu'
return self
def cuda(self, device=None):
super().cuda(device)
self.device = 'cuda'
return self
@property
def log_str(self):
return f'{self._get_name()}: {self.cameras}'
